Summary
Disable access to the websites you specify. When a blacklisted website is visited, it asks user for password. If user doesn't know password, he is not allowed to access the website. Ideal to protect kids from youtube crap.

This extension is only for my personal purposes, because it is no longer possible to add own chrome extensions to chrome without going through the chrome store. It is ridiculous that Google now charges money even for myself using my own extension on my own browser ... anyway, no support will be provided for this item. help yourself :)

Risk impact measures the level of extra permissions an extension has access to. A low risk impact extension cannot do much harms, whereas a high risk impact extension can do a lot of damage like stealing your password, bypass your security settings, and access your personal data. High risk impact extensions are not necessarily malicious. However, if they do turn malicious, they can be very harmful.

Risk likelihood measures the probability that a Chrome extension may turn malicious. This is determined by the publisher and the Chrome extension reputation on Chrome Web Store, the amount of time the Chrome extension has been around, and other signals about the Chrome extension. Our algorithms are not perfect, and are subject to change as we discover new ways to detect malicious extensions.
